Estimating fundamental parameters of nearby M dwarfs from SPIRou spectra

ABSTRACT We present the results of a study aiming at retrieving fundamental parameters M dwarfs from spectra secured with SPIRou, near-infrared high-resolution spectropolarimeter installed Canada–France–Hawaii Telescope (CFHT), in framework SPIRou Legacy Survey (SLS). Our relies on comparing observed two grids synthetic spectra, respectively, computed PHOENIX and MARCS model atmospheres, ultimate goal optimizing precision which can be determined. In this first step, we applied our technique to 12 inactive effective temperatures (Teff) ranging 3000 4000 K. implemented benchmark carry out comparison models used study. report that choice has significant impact may lead discrepancies derived 30 K Teff 0.05 dex 0.10 surface gravity (log g) metallicity ($\rm {[M/H]}$), as well systematic shifts up 50 0.4 log g $\rm {[M/H]}$. The analysis is performed high signal-to-noise ratio template averaged over multiple observations corrected telluric absorption features sky lines, using both transmission principal component analysis. With models, retrieve Teff, g, {[M/H]}$ estimates good agreement reference literature studies, internal error bars about K, dex, 0.1 respectively.

Spitzer-IRAC Search for Companions to Nearby, Young M Dwarfs

We present the results of a survey of nearby, young M stars for wide low-mass companions with IRAC on the Spitzer Space Telescope. We observed 40 young M dwarfs within 20 pc of the Sun, selected through X-ray emission criteria. A total of 10 candidate companions were found with IRAC colors consistent with T dwarfs.
